spidernet: introduce new setting
We found a new chip setting that we need in order to make the driver work more reliable. Signed-off-by: Arnd Bergmann <arnd.bergmann@de.ibm.com> Signed-off-by: Stephen Hemminger <shemminger@osdl.org>
This commit is contained in:
parent
aedc0e520e
commit
b636d17a3b
|
@ -1652,6 +1652,8 @@ spider_net_enable_card(struct spider_net_card *card)
|
||||||
{ SPIDER_NET_GFTRESTRT, SPIDER_NET_RESTART_VALUE },
|
{ SPIDER_NET_GFTRESTRT, SPIDER_NET_RESTART_VALUE },
|
||||||
|
|
||||||
{ SPIDER_NET_GMRWOLCTRL, 0 },
|
{ SPIDER_NET_GMRWOLCTRL, 0 },
|
||||||
|
{ SPIDER_NET_GTESTMD, 0x10000000 },
|
||||||
|
{ SPIDER_NET_GTTQMSK, 0x00400040 },
|
||||||
{ SPIDER_NET_GTESTMD, 0 },
|
{ SPIDER_NET_GTESTMD, 0 },
|
||||||
|
|
||||||
{ SPIDER_NET_GMACINTEN, 0 },
|
{ SPIDER_NET_GMACINTEN, 0 },
|
||||||
|
|
|
@ -120,6 +120,8 @@ extern char spider_net_driver_name[];
|
||||||
#define SPIDER_NET_GMRUAFILnR 0x00000500
|
#define SPIDER_NET_GMRUAFILnR 0x00000500
|
||||||
#define SPIDER_NET_GMRUA0FIL15R 0x00000578
|
#define SPIDER_NET_GMRUA0FIL15R 0x00000578
|
||||||
|
|
||||||
|
#define SPIDER_NET_GTTQMSK 0x00000934
|
||||||
|
|
||||||
/* RX DMA controller registers, all 0x00000a.. are for DMA controller A,
|
/* RX DMA controller registers, all 0x00000a.. are for DMA controller A,
|
||||||
* 0x00000b.. for DMA controller B, etc. */
|
* 0x00000b.. for DMA controller B, etc. */
|
||||||
#define SPIDER_NET_GDADCHA 0x00000a00
|
#define SPIDER_NET_GDADCHA 0x00000a00
|
||||||
|
|
Loading…
Reference in New Issue